Key Features
Light curable flowable composites are characterized by low viscosity, superior adaptability, and ease of handling. Their key features include excellent esthetics, reduced polymerization shrinkage, and strong bonding to tooth structures. These composites can be cured quickly using visible light sources, enabling efficient and precise restorations. Enhanced wear resistance and improved polishability further strengthen their appeal among dental professionals.
Applications
The composites are widely used in restorative dentistry for cavity liners, small Class I restorations, Class III and V restorations, and pit and fissure sealants. They are also utilized in repairing composite or ceramic veneers and in minimally invasive procedures where aesthetics and precision are critical. Their versatility makes them a preferred choice for both pediatric and adult dental treatments.

Trends
A notable trend is the shift toward nanotechnology-based flowable composites, which offer better mechanical properties and enhanced esthetics. There is also growing adoption of bulk-fill flowable composites that allow deeper curing in fewer increments, reducing chair time. Furthermore, dental practices are increasingly integrating digital workflows, which complement the use of advanced restorative materials.
